Referee chosen and time set for this weekend's Kildare Senior Hurling Championship Final

Reigning champions Naas are going for seven Kildare SHC's in a row and Maynooth are once again again the team trying to stop them

Matthew Redmond will be the referee for this weekend's 2025 UPMC Kildare Senior Hurling Championship Final between Naas and Maynooth.

The decider is set for Cedral St Conleth's Park this Sunday, October 12 at 3:30pm.

Maynooth will be aiming for a similar feat to the St Laurence's ladies, who stopped Eadestown's push for six Championships in a row last weekend.
